Transaction 5aaa981a113a12aad940b231af0fe79e0e80a0fe45e4cd68efc87eb717122bfd
1 Input
1 Output
-
5aaa981a113a12aad940b231af0fe79e0e80a0fe45e4cd68efc87eb717122bfd:0
- value
- 758416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c5ec95f6be0f8555ca0dbeef2d66ae73f45f850 OP_EQUAL
- address
- 3EVE5HjRpzDr7QmZKGWNGSgdS85hXARRD3